(Om Records/Stomp)
Founded in the mid nineties, San Franciscan based label, ‘Om Records’ has built itself a reputation for consistently producing fresh, innovative and above all timeless house music. With a gamut of forward looking artists on their books, and an equal number of production heavy weights ready to put their own unique twist on the Om sound, comes the second in the ‘OM remixed’ series.
Opening proceedings is Miguel Migs remixing his own 2004 release ‘Come On’; it’s a warm and sensuous track that instantly engages you. The album then slinks its way towards late night dance floor specialist ‘Kaskade’, who gets a going over of the bump and grind kind from Canada’s Jason Hodges, a definite standout on the album. Having produced his first major release with Mushroom Jazz’s Mark Farina, it is only fitting to have Derrick Carter putting his trademark quality sound to Farina’s ‘To Do’, later on in the album Farina also gets reworked by DJ Fluid, who enhances the already hypnotically beautiful ‘Dream Machine’ with delicate electronic treasures.
Jacob London gets busy with some deep rhythmic basslines and steps up the funk with ‘Rithma’s’, ‘Everyone is sleeping today,’ whilst Kaskade fuses his fresh, pulsating blend of house to aFRO-mYSTIK’s original deep house groove ‘Natural’. The tempo then lifts with Doron Orenstein and Gabriel D Vin (aka Monkey Bars) who add some juicy jacking beats to the Kaskade hit ‘Steppin Out’. With no fear of slowing down, the vibe continues to pulse with France’s Pepe Bradock who adds his uniquely tasteful but very sexy style to Soulstice’s ‘Tenderly’, and no Om album is complete without the rhythm and b-boy soul of ‘PUTS’, who take to J Boogie’s ‘Try Me’ with an impressive array of warmth and style.
Guaranteed to satisfy each and every time, reMixed 2 is what real house music sounds like.
